This article will discuss how to flip text so that it appears like a mirror reflection in MS Word. The task is carried out using the Word Art feature. However, the default Word Art settings will not allow you to see a full reflection, so we will work with the settings to make sure you see 100% of the reflected text.

Now your text will have an effect which will have a reflected text like a mirror image underneath. You can modify the Reflection Settings to change the way the reflection appears.
If you wish to change the color or the font, simply highlight your text and choose a different font color. Same can be done for increasing and decreasing the font size.
The above technique works with Word 2010, Word 2013 and Word 2016.
